Final exams were held in April 1868, and produced the following results.[1]
Sixty-two cadets took the exams. Their rank in order of merit was as follows.
- Henry George Thursfield
- Robert Radcliffe Cooke
- Douglas
- George Bridges Lewis
- Nathaniel Thomas Carrington (lasted very short time in service)
- Lindreex
- Adrian St. Vincent Keyes
- Eric Gascoigne Robinson
- Clement Charles Swift
- Andrew Browne Cunningham
- Rowe
- Browne
- Thomas
- James Douglas Campbell
- Henry Archer Colt
- Edmond Alan Berners Stanley
- John David Napier Burnett
- Arthur Henry Durrant Field
- Francis Allen Newton Cromie
- Herbert Seymour Webb Boldero
- James Fownes Somerville
- Charles Henry Aubrey Cartwright
- Walter John Fletcher
- Charles Campbell Lambert
- Charles James Colebrooke Little
- James Sacheverell Constable Hutton
- Basil Richard Poë
- Edmund David Faber
- Boughey
- Ralph Stuart Wykes-SneydRalph Stuart Sneyd
- Hugh Hamilton-Gordon
- Joseph Gordon Walsh
- Cameron
- John Pelham Champion
- Richard Bruce England
- Frederick Wilfred Law
- Hore
- John Spencer Tyndall
- Madroz
- Richard Thornton Down
- Lionel Edward Henry Royle
- Cloudesley Varyl Robinson
- Lancelot Alan Smythies
- Percy Dumayne Campbell
- Robert Francis Veasey
- Lane
- Francis Edward Byrne
- Charles Gordon Ramsey
- Evelyn Adam Govett
- Robert Edgeworth Johnston
- Herbert Francis Littledale
- Smith
- Arthur George Coke
- Clinton Francis Samuel Danby
- Arthur Winnifred Benson
- Maurice Brett Leslie
